About this work

This painting shows a horse and three people in riding gear. The horse is white and stands to the left, while the people are on the right. The people are dressed in long coats and hats, and one of them holds a riding crop. The painting is done in muted colors, with shades of blue and green dominating the palette. The brushstrokes are loose and expressive, giving the painting a sense of movement and energy. The painting is part of the collection at the Statens Museum for Kunst.
